We spent this past weekend (May 16-17) in Northern Michigan. Hubby and I went on a 2-day trail ride offered by the owner of Sandy Korners in Silver Lake, MI. Jack Warfield is probably one of the nicest guys in our hobby that you could ever meet. He’s been trail riding in Northern Michigan for the better part of 27 years. The group on this trip was small – 6 Jeeps: four Wranglers – various years, various mods, a totally stock 2008 KK and my 2002 KJ Renegade.
First day of the trip we covered approximately 125 miles. The trails wound through the Manistee National Forest. This was the challenging day. It had been raining quite a bit the past week and the trails were quite muddy – even the “big boys” got stuck.
